VOA Workshop Descriptions
                                            The “Voices Of Africa” Choral & Percussion Ensemble is an all female a
                                            cappella and West African percussion ensemble based in Philadelphia. We have a
                                            unique sound and presence that has opened opportunities for us to perform all
                                            over the country and abroad. Along with our performances, we offer Work-
                                            shops, Lecture Demos and Residencies where we teach how to play the different
                                            instruments that we use in our ensemble. Those instruments are the Sekere, Sa-
                                            kara drum, Ago go bell and Sangba drum. We also infuse Brazilian percussion
                                            into our predominantly West African rhythms and style to create fun and unique
                                            sounds that our participants enjoy learning. We propose a single workshop or
                                            workshop series (Residency Program) dealing with percussion and a workshop
     Omega Institute, July 2005             series that teaches how to make the Sekere (beaded gourd) instrument. We
       Photo: Dave Blanton                  make our own sekeres and we conduct workshops for adults teaching them how
                                            to make their own. At the completion of the workshop series, each participant
                                            will have their own sekere that they can take home with them.

                                              Workshop Programs
Single workshop consisting of teaching how to play the West African instruments and creating rhythms. It will end with a
drum circle where participants can utilize what they have learned and what comes naturally to play the instruments. No ma-
terials needed (we bring the instruments with us and have enough for up to 50 participants, however we do offer a drum for
each participant to take home for a fee of $25 per person). This workshop is suitable for ages 6 and up, however we do not
recommend any longer than 1 hour for ages 6-16.
Fee: 1 hour- $800.
Workshop Series/Residencies: we will teach several classes either on a weekly basis or consistently over one week (5 days) the vari-
ous instruments and rhythms concentrating on West African and Brazilian percussions. We will also teach songs that coincide with the
different rhythms. Participants will learn the intricacies of how to create the music and how to sing traditional songs along with playing
the instruments. Additionally, participants will be exposed to West African Culture, dance, customs, clothes, food, names, games and
storytelling. The series will end with a grand presentation; complete with singers, drummers, dancers and African Marketplace. Work-
shops can be costumed designed to suit your needs.
Fee: 5 classes- $3500 total, ages 6 and up. A $25 materials fee can be included for each participant for them to receive
a Sakara drum of their own.
Lecture-Demo: In this 60 minute presentation, the
audience will be given 20 minutes of a performance.
The remaining 40 minutes will be used to inform the
audience about history, technique and style of playing
each instrument used in the performance. In
addition, the audience will be asked to participate in
playing the instruments. Lecture-Demos are
designed for children and adult audiences.

                                                         Sekere making workshop series, where participants learn to make the West
                                                         African beaded gourd. We will teach them some of the many patterns of bead-
                                                         work they can use and also teach them about the instrument and how it is
                                                         played. They will also paint and decorate their sekere to their personal taste. By
                                                         the end of the series, they will have their very own sekere and know how to play
                                                         it. 90 minutes each day, weekly or within one week, ages 16 and up.
